Exemple #1
0
def _list():
    clubs = Club.query().order_by(func.lower(Club.name))

    name_filter = request.args.get("name")
    if name_filter:
        clubs = clubs.filter_by(name=name_filter)

    return jsonify(clubs=ClubSchema(only=("id", "name")).dump(clubs, many=True).data)
Exemple #2
0
def _listClubsByName():
    clubs = Club.query().order_by(func.lower(Club.name))

    name_filter = request.args.get("name")
    if name_filter:
        clubs = clubs.filter_by(name=name_filter)

    return jsonify(clubs=ClubSchema(only=("id", "name")).dump(clubs, many=True).data)
Exemple #3
0
def list():
    clubs = Club.query().order_by(func.lower(Club.name))

    name_filter = request.args.get('name')
    if name_filter:
        clubs = clubs.filter_by(name=name_filter)

    return jsonify(clubs=ClubSchema(only=('id', 'name')).dump(clubs, many=True).data)
Exemple #4
0
def index():
    if 'application/json' not in request.headers.get('Accept', ''):
        return render_template('ember-page.jinja', active_page='settings')

    clubs = Club.query().order_by(func.lower(Club.name))

    name_filter = request.args.get('name')
    if name_filter:
        clubs = clubs.filter_by(name=name_filter)

    return jsonify(clubs=ClubSchema(only=('id', 'name')).dump(clubs, many=True).data)
Exemple #5
0
def index():
    if 'application/json' not in request.headers.get('Accept', ''):
        return render_template('ember-page.jinja', active_page='settings')

    clubs = Club.query().order_by(func.lower(Club.name))

    name_filter = request.args.get('name')
    if name_filter:
        clubs = clubs.filter_by(name=name_filter)

    return jsonify(clubs=ClubSchema(only=('id',
                                          'name')).dump(clubs, many=True).data)
Exemple #6
0
def index():
    clubs = Club.query().order_by(func.lower(Club.name))
    return render_template(
        'clubs/list.jinja', active_page='settings', clubs=clubs)
Exemple #7
0
    def process(self, *args, **kwargs):
        users = Club.query().order_by(Club.name)
        self.choices = [(0, "[" + l_("No club") + "]")]
        self.choices.extend([(user.id, user) for user in users])

        super(ClubsSelectField, self).process(*args, **kwargs)
def index():
    clubs = Club.query().order_by(func.lower(Club.name))
    return render_template('clubs/list.jinja',
                           active_page='settings',
                           clubs=clubs)
Exemple #9
0
    def process(self, *args, **kwargs):
        users = Club.query().order_by(Club.name)
        self.choices = [(0, '[' + l_('No club') + ']')]
        self.choices.extend([(user.id, user) for user in users])

        super(ClubsSelectField, self).process(*args, **kwargs)